1878-P VAM-44A 3 TF, Clashed Obverse n & st, Reverse M Discovered August 2003 by Mark Kimpton. Revision January 2004 by Mark Kimpton and again October 2004 by Leroy Van Allen This coin is a Top 100 Morgan VAM as well as a 2011 John Roberts 11. '''44A'''(revised) '''II/I 37 · B/Ad (3 TF, Clashed Obverse n & st, Reverse M) (179) ''' '''Obverse II/I 37–''' Clashed die w/ partial incuse n of In from reverse showing next to Liberty's neck & partial incuse st of Trust from reverse showing in right hair vee of lower hair edge. '''Reverse B/Ad–''' Clashed die with raised designer’s initial M from obverse showing above d of God.
